Work with Equipment Used in Today's Security Industry
Modern surveillance technology includes a wide range of devices designed for different environments and security requirements. Throughout the course, students become familiar with the equipment commonly used by professional technicians. Training covers IP camera installation, Analog CCTV systems, recording units, monitors, storage devices, connectors, and power supplies. Students also learn basic CCTV networking, helping them understand how modern cameras communicate through local networks and internet connections. Practical lessons also introduce cable management, equipment positioning, and installation safety. Learning with real tools gives students valuable experience that improves both technical ability and workplace readiness.

Learn Troubleshooting and Repair Through Practical Experience
A successful technician must know how to identify problems quickly and restore system performance efficiently. The CCTV Technician Course in Peshawar introduces basic CCTV repair concepts, allowing students to understand common technical faults and practical repair methods. Learners practice identifying connection problems, checking recording equipment, testing camera performance, and resolving simple installation issues.
They also improve their CCTV maintenance skills by performing routine inspections that help prevent equipment failure before it becomes a major problem. This combination of maintenance and troubleshooting knowledge makes graduates more valuable because employers often prefer technicians who can both install and support surveillance systems.
Career Paths Available After Completing the Course
The security industry offers many opportunities for individuals with practical technical knowledge. After completing the CCTV Technician Course in Peshawar, graduates can work with security companies, construction firms, educational institutions, healthcare facilities, factories, commercial businesses, and government organizations that use surveillance systems. Many students begin as installation assistants, security system technicians, maintenance technicians, technical support staff, or professional CCTV technicians.
As they gain experience, they can move into senior technical positions or supervise larger installation projects involving advanced surveillance technology. The wide range of industries using CCTV systems means technicians have flexibility when choosing their future workplace, making this profession both practical and rewarding.
